10 pct of increase in Iranian hand-woven carpet exports

SHAFAQNA- The exports of Iranian hand-woven carpet have increased 10% during the first 4 months of the current Iranian fiscal year, according to the head of the National Union of Cooperatives of Iran’s Carpet Manufacturers.

The head of the National Union of Cooperatives of Irans Carpet Manufacturers, Abdollah Bharami said, sanctions alone cannot affect on Iranian carpet market and the exports of that, Irna reported.

He added, “According to Iranian Customs statistics, the value of Iranian hand-woven carpet exports increased 20 percent during the first 4 months of the current Iranian fiscal year, comparing to the last year that the value was about $400 million”.

“On the average, we have saw 15 to 20 percent growth year by year,” he said.
